- Step Free Access
Category B. This station has a degree of step free access to the platform which may be in both directions or in one direction only - please check for details.
Wheelchair users may need assistance on Platform 1 as there are no lowered kerbs on the pavements and the gradient of the ramp to the platform is steep. The gradient of the ramp to Platform 2 is moderate.
This station has tactile paving at the edge of each platform.

- Step Free Access
Category B1.
Step free access to Platform 1 (to Swansea) and 2 to Cardiff) from Hendre Road.
Access between the platforms is available via the level crossing and footbridge with steps
